Reequil is a brand that offers different types of moisturizers, including the Ceramide & Hyaluronic Acid Moisturizer and the Oil-Free Mattifying Moisturizer. Here is a breakdown of the ingredients and materials used in these products:

Reequil Ceramide & Hyaluronic Acid Moisturizer:

  • Key Ingredients: Ceramide III, Hyaluronic Acid
  • Other Ingredients: Aqua, Caprylic/Capric Triglycerides, Myristyl Myristate, Glycerin, Cetearyl Alcohol, Glyceryl Stearate, PEG-100 Stearate, Sodium PCA, Sodium Lactate, Arginine, Aspartic Acid, PCA, Glycine, Alanine, Serine, Valine, Proline, Threonine, Isoleucine, Histidine, Phenylalanine, Sodium Hyaluronate, Xylitylglucoside, Anhydroxylitol, Xylitol, Caprylyl Glycol, Ethylhexylglycerin, Butylene Glycol, Sodium Gluconate, Carbomer, Triethanolamine, Phenoxyethanol

Positive:

  • Contains Ceramide III and Hyaluronic Acid, which are beneficial for the skins natural lipid barrier and hydration, respectively.
  • Fragrance-free.

Negative:

  • Contains some ingredients that may cause irritation or be comedogenic for some people, such as Cetearyl Alcohol, Glyceryl Stearate, and Butylene Glycol.
  • Contains Carbomer, which may cause allergic reactions in some people.

Reequil Oil-Free Mattifying Moisturizer:

  • Key Ingredients: Biosaccharide Gum-1, Niacinamide, Zinc PCA
  • Other Ingredients: Aqua, Propanediol, Cyclopentasiloxane, Biosaccharide Gum-1, Cydonia Oblonga Leaf Extract, Niacinamide, Zinc PCA, Sodium Polyacrylate, Dimethicone Crosspolymer, PEG-12 Dimethicone/PPG-20 Crosspolymer, Dimethicone/Vinyl Dimethicone Crosspolymer, Phenoxyethanol, Ethylhexylglycerin

Positive:

  • Contains Biosaccharide Gum-1, which can help soothe and moisturize the skin.
  • Contains Niacinamide and Zinc PCA, which can help regulate sebum production and reduce the appearance of pores.

Negative:

  • Contains some ingredients that may cause irritation or be comedogenic for some people, such as Cyclopentasiloxane and Dimethicone.
  • Contains Phenoxyethanol, which may cause allergic reactions in some people.

In summary, both Reequil moisturizers contain some beneficial ingredients for the skin, but they also contain some ingredients that may cause irritation or be comedogenic for some people.
